The day's lunch cost about RM800 for 7 pax. I guess it is okay, since Elegant Inn is an award winning Hong Kong restaurant.

Whether a restaurant is good or bad, the waitress plays an important role here.

We were introduced to this interesting claypot fish dish, where the grouper is pre-fried before boiling in herbal soup in a claypot with yam. This dish is delicious max man!

The goodness essence of the fish soup.

Pork neck with spring onion... or was it leek? The meat was very tender.

This dish is about quite interesting. They deboned the chicken and stuffed it with prawn and then fry... Ooo - la - la!!!

This dish is the most expensive of all. Claypot fish maw. I am not a fish maw person, but this is okay for me.

Stir fry salted vegetable with bitter gourd. Yupe! You heard me.

Last but not least, the longevity noodles.

Overall experience? Bravo!!! Magnifico!!!
